The Origin Story

Car #31 — The Antithesis
of James Dean's #13

In 1994, the reproduction of this Porsche Spyder was christened "Spyder Juice." Car number 31 was chosen as the antithesis to James Dean's legendary Spyder, car number 13. The unlucky number 13 transformed — as 31 took the stage on the Electric Car Racing Circuit.

Designed to race in the All Electric Sun Day Challenge and the Tour De Sol Races, this early version of the Electric Car won every Sun Day Challenge entered since 1995. Spyder Juice raced across parts of the USA and quickly became a legend, winning acceleration and Auto Cross Challenges.

Built by Al Simpler and Gary Flow, the car raced at speeds of 130 mph. In Tour de Sol, the Juice was the only car to outrun the test car 280 ZX — a gasoline-powered vehicle.

The Legacy

From Spyder Juice,
the Solar Charging Station Was Born

The experimental motor featured in the Spyder Juice prompted other countries to implement this technology in their Electric Car Designs. At one event, our Charging Station powered the Goodyear tire truck providing tires for racing competitors.

From this design, the Solar Charging Station was born — and it is available in its next generation form today. The Station was also a featured item at Epcot Center, cementing Simpler Solar's place in the history of renewable energy innovation.

The faces of the support race team changed over the years, but Al Simpler remains a pioneer in the beginning of the Electric Car Race. Today, we look to the new Electric Cars with great anticipation.
